      Hi Paul, first thing I’d check is the fluid level in the reservoir. If it’s gone down you may have a leak. I’ve found it’s most likely in a slave cylinder in one of the wheel drums. If that’s ok they may need adjustment. There is no automatic adjustment as your brake shoes wear down. The thing to do is jack each wheel up in turn and look through the peep hole on the front of the drum with a flashlight as you turn the wheel. You will see the slave cylinder and a toothed wheel on the end. If you use a screwdriver turn the toothed wheel until you start to feel a small amount of resistance when the shoe touches the drum. Do this on all wheels and it may improve. Hope this helps
